David Lazar 3bde7ec13c platform/x86: Add s2idle quirk for more Lenovo laptops
When suspending to idle and resuming on some Lenovo laptops using the
Mendocino APU, multiple NVME IOMMU page faults occur, showing up in
dmesg as repeated errors:

nvme 0000:01:00.0: AMD-Vi: Event logged [IO_PAGE_FAULT domain=0x000b
address=0xb6674000 flags=0x0000]

The system is unstable afterwards.

Applying the s2idle quirk introduced by commit 455cd867b8 ("platform/x86:
thinkpad_acpi: Add a s2idle resume quirk for a number of laptops")
allows these systems to work with the IOMMU enabled and s2idle
resume to work.

/*
* Laptops that run a SMI handler during the D3->D0 transition that occurs
* specifically when exiting suspend to idle which can cause
* large delays during resume when the IOMMU translation layer is enabled (the default
* behavior) for NVME devices:
*
* To avoid this firmware problem, skip the SMI handler on these machines before the
* D0 transition occurs.
*/
static void amd_pmc_skip_nvme_smi_handler(u32 s2idle_bug_mmio)
{
void __iomem *addr;
u8 val;
if (!request_mem_region_muxed(s2idle_bug_mmio, 1, "amd_pmc_pm80"))
return;
addr = ioremap(s2idle_bug_mmio, 1);
if (!addr)
goto cleanup_resource;
val = ioread8(addr);
iowrite8(val & ~BIT(0), addr);
iounmap(addr);
cleanup_resource:
release_mem_region(s2idle_bug_mmio, 1);
}
void amd_pmc_process_restore_quirks(struct amd_pmc_dev *dev)
{
if (dev->quirks && dev->quirks->s2idle_bug_mmio)
amd_pmc_skip_nvme_smi_handler(dev->quirks->s2idle_bug_mmio);
}
void amd_pmc_quirks_init(struct amd_pmc_dev *dev)
{
const struct dmi_system_id *dmi_id;
dmi_id = dmi_first_match(fwbug_list);
if (!dmi_id)
return;
dev->quirks = dmi_id->driver_data;
if (dev->quirks->s2idle_bug_mmio)
pr_info("Using s2idle quirk to avoid %s platform firmware bug\n",
dmi_id->ident);
}
